Service level management

In Introducing service level management, Dan Holloran of New Relic reviews and demonstrates the basics of SLOs and SLIs.

Why Thanos for LTS

Elastisys sharing their story and experience in Why we selected Thanos for long term metrics storage. Thanks and we can definitely benefit from more of these evaluations made public.

OpenTelemetry and Jaeger

Robert Baumgartner's article on Using OpenTelemetry and Jaeger with Your Own Services/Application is a hands-on deep dive, with an Quarkus application on OpenShift as example workload.

Java observability in action

Learn from Ruben Mondejar about the First steps in Monitoring Micronaut apps with Prometheus and Grafana, showing the JVM framework in action, focusing on monitoring.

Go auto-instrumentation

Check out keyval-dev/opentelemetry-go-instrumentation which is a rather new open source project that enables you to do OpenTelemetry auto-instrumentation for Go apps based on eBPF. Kudos to Eden Federman!

EKS add-on for OpenTelemetry

We launched this last week and my colleagues Viji Sarathy, Michael Hauss, and Eric Hsueh wrote a nice blog post about it: Metrics and traces collection using Amazon EKS add-ons for AWS Distro for OpenTelemetry.

OpenTelemetry and Python

Check out OpenTelemetry and Python: A complete instrumentation guide by James Blackwood-Sewell of Timescale, via the CNCF blog.
